Be Aware: Scam Indicators
Before falling headfirst into any online or phone deal, take a moment and look over the situation. Scammers are astute, so being vigilant is your best defense. Here are some frequent red flags to watch out for: more info
- Demand to act quickly without thinking things through.
- Promises that seem too good to be true—they usually are.
- Demands for personal or financial information via phone calls.
- Unprofessional websites with broken links, poor grammar, or outdated contact information.
- Unexpected contact about winning a prize or inheritance you never entered.
If you spot any of these red flags, exercise caution. Don't be afraid to walk away the offer and research the company or individual further.

Trapped by Deception: The Psychology of Scams
Scammers utilize psychological warfare to lure unsuspecting victims into falling prey to their schemes. They manipulate our natural biases, utilizing feelings of greed, fear, or even simple hope. By creating a sense of urgency and offering unrealistic rewards, scammers construct narratives that manipulate our conscious minds. Understanding these psychological mechanisms is crucial for defending ourselves against the ever-evolving world of scams.
- Stay aware when receiving unsolicited offers.
- Double-check information from trusted institutions.
- Refrain from acting impulsively based on pressure.
